What Is the GMAT Score Range for BitSoM MBA Admissions?
![What Is the GMAT Score Range for BitSoM MBA Admissions?]()
BitSoM accepts a wide range of GMAT scores for its MBA program. Based on the latest class profile, the GMAT score range for accepted students is 600 to 770. This shows that both average and high scorers are welcomed, as long as the rest of the profile is strong.
The BitSoM MBA GMAT Score helps the admissions team understand your academic readiness, but it is not the only thing they look at. Your work experience, college grades, and personal achievements also matter.

BitSoM MBA Class Profile: GMAT Insights
The BITS School of Management (BitSoM) in Mumbai attracts a diverse cohort of MBA students, with GMAT scores playing a significant role in the admissions process. The BITSoM MBA Class of 2025, the GMAT score range among admitted students was 600 to 770, with a median score of 690.
The BitSoM MBA GMAT Score provides insight into the academic caliber of the cohort. While a strong GMAT score can enhance an application, BitSoM evaluates candidates holistically, considering academic background, work experience, and personal achievements.
| General Information |
| Total Students |
154 |
| Gender Diversity |
45% Women, 55% Me |
| Academic Background |
| Engineering |
53% |
| Commerce/Business |
30% |
| Science |
5% |
| Arts |
12% |
| Work Experience |
| Freshers |
25% |
| Less than 2 years |
26% |
| 2 to 4 years |
41% |
| More than 4 years |
8% |

BitSoM MBA Admission Process: Key Dates and Deadlines
![BitSoM MBA Admission Process: Key Dates and Deadlines]()
The BITS School of Management (BitSoM) has officially announced the admission timeline for its MBA program for the academic year 2025–27. Applicants should keep track of the following key dates to ensure a smooth application process.
Below are the official deadlines:
- Application Start Date: March 17, 2025
- Application End Date: April 13, 2025
- Interview Period: April – May 2025
- Result Declaration: May 12, 2025
- Fee Payment Deadline: As per the offer letter
- Course Commencement: May 23, 2025
To apply, candidates must submit a valid test score from CAT, GMAT, GMAT Focus, or GRE. While the BitSoM MBA GMAT Score is important, the school also evaluates academic background, work experience, personal essays, and interviews.
